Kenney M. Green

Director / Choreographer

 

Kenney M. Green is a native of Fresno, California who has lived in New York since 1999.  He attended Fresno State University, California and continued his education at The American Musical and Dramatic Academy.  He left the conservatory to join the European Tour of THE MUSIC OF ANDREW LLOYD WEBBER and then immediately joined the National Tour of SMOKEY JOE'S CAFE starring Grammy Award Winner Gladys Knight under Joey McKneely.  Off-Broadway: GROWING UP '70's WITH BARRY WILLIAMS, FAIRYTALE, RHODA HEARTBREAK.  Regional: AIN'T MISBEHAVIN, A CHORUS LINE, SUGAR BABIES, HOW TO SUCCEED..., MY ONE AND ONLY.  He has served as Assistant Choreographer/Director on numerous shows:  THE KING AND I, OLIVER, A CHORUS LINE, FOREVER PLAID, NUNSENSE, GYPSY. Kenney also has the wonderful fortune of working collegiately.  He was chosen to be the Visiting Musical Theatre Professor at Rollins College and will be spending a second summer with The University of Southern Indiana/New Harmony Theatre on their upcoming musical!

John Treacy Egan

Director

 

John most recently appeared on Broadway in NICE WORK IF YOU CAN GET IT, and also featured in the 2009 revival of BYE BYE BIRDIE. He created the role of Chef Louis in DISNEY'S THE LITTLE MERMAID on Broadway, as well as the role of Joey in SISTER ACT. He played Max Bialystock in the Broadway production of THE PRODUCERS as well as the roles of Roger DeBris and Franz Liebkind. He was an original cast member of the Broadway production of JEKYLL & HYDE, and has toured the U.S. and Europe in productions of KISS ME KATE and CATS.
He has appeared on television in BOARDWALK EMPIRE, 30 ROCK, CUPID, LAW & ORDER, LATE NIGHT with CONAN O'BRIEN, and AS THE WORLD TURNS  and the films LAST NIGHT, and the film version of THE PRODUCERS.
He can be heard on many theatrical recordings and on many volumes of BROADWAY'S GREATEST GIFTS as well as Linda Eder's Christmas Stays The Same.
His solo CDs Count the Stars and On Christmas Morning are available on itunes and cdbaby.com.

Kevin B. Winebold

Music Director

 

​​Kevin B. Winebold is a musical director/actor from Elmira, New York, where he holds a BA in theatre from Elmira College.  New York credits include the Broadway concert version of Camelot starring Jeremy Irons (rehearsal accompanist/ensemble), The off-Broadway musical The Irish...and How They Got That Way at the Irish Repertory Theatre (musical director/ensemble/tap dancer), and Songs For A New World at the Chernuchin Theater (conductor/keyboards).  For Prather Entertainment Group, Kevin toured with the national productions of All Shook Up, The Wedding Singer, and Footloose.  Internationally, Kevin was a voice and tap teacher in Seoul, Korea, a musical director in Osaka, Japan, and a recital pianist in Limerick, Ireland.  www.kevinbwinebold.com

Cynthia Alonzo

Choreographer

 

Cynthia Alonzo has been dancing for 19 years and teaching for 6. She has been trained in ballet, modern, tap, jazz, hip hop, and musical theatre. Cynthia has performed at such venues as Ulster Performing Arts Center, Madison Square Garden, and New York's City Center. Cynthia recently graduated this May from Manhattanville College with a Bachelors Degree in Dance and Theatre. 

 

Jenna Dallacco

Assistant Director

 

JENNA DALLACCO has been working professionally as a performer, voice teacher and teaching artist in New York City and Westchester County since 2005. She graduated summa cum laude from NYU Steinhardt with a Bachelor of Music in Voice and a minor in Speech Pathology and Audiology. Jenna has become a sought after young vocalist, performing in various revues, musicals and cabarets.  Favorite New York City credits include: "Marry Harry" and "Cruel Shoes" (NYMF), "Last Days of Gotham" (Industry Reading), "Urinetown" (F. Loewe Theatre) "Queen Esther" (Kaufman Center). As a cabaret artist, she has had the privilege of guest starring in revues at Feinstein's at the Recency, Birdland, and The Kirland PAC. As a teaching artist, she has had the pleasure of working with the Sandbox on "The Little Mermaid Jr," "Bye Bye Birdie," "Oliver!" and "You're a Good Man Charlie Brown."  Jenna holds the distinction of being a member of the critically acclaimed "Broadway By the Year" cabaret series at The Town Hall in Manhattan. She has sung for and with the likes of Alan Menken, Michael Feinstein, Peter Asher, Marc Kudish, Emily Skinner, Tovah Feldshuh, Celeste Holm, Kerry O'Malley Rebecca Luker, Sheldon Harnick and Patrick Paige. Union affiliations include Actor's Equity and the New York State Singing Teacher's Association.
